Peoria Koshiba (born June 27, 1979 in Ngerbeched ) is a former Palauian sprinter .

biography

Peoria Koshiba started at the World Athletics Championships in 1997 over 100 m and finished 56th. At the Olympic Games in Sydney in 2000 , she finished 68th over the same distance. At the World Championships in the following year she was able to improve to 53rd place. Koshiba won a total of five gold medals at the 1998 and 2006 Micronesia Games . At the Olympic Games in Beijing in 2008 , she started in the 100-meter run , but retired with a time of 13.18 seconds as the last in her prelim.

After her career, she worked in the office of the Palau Track and Field Association , coaching the country's junior athletes.
